Keeping your old data
Mac OS X users :
AuctionSieve now stores your data internally in the app. To use your existing data, you’ll need to do the following:
- Open up the folder where you currently have the old AuctionSieve
- Control click the new AuctionSieve icon and select “Show Package Contents” from the pop-up menu
- Navigate to the Contents->Resources->Java folder
- Copy the following files to that folder:
all .sieve files
auctionsieve.properties
watchlist.txt
pricehistory.txt

Windows users :
You can install the new version into the same location as your old version – all your data will remain safe.
